1. Set Realistic Goals
When it comes to working out, setting realistic goals is crucial. The key is to start small and gradually increase your targets as you progress. Setting unattainable goals can lead to frustration and a lack of motivation.
Instead, break your fitness journey into achievable milestones and celebrate each accomplishment along the way.
2. Find an Activity You Love
Not all workouts are created equal. Find an activity that you genuinely enjoy and incorporate it into your fitness routine. Whether it’s dancing, swimming, hiking, or playing a sport, choose something that makes you excited to move your body.
When you love what you’re doing, exercise doesn’t feel like a chore anymore.
3. Mix Things Up
Doing the same workout routine day after day can quickly become monotonous. Keep things interesting by mixing up your exercises.
Try new workouts, join group classes, or switch between different types of training such as cardio, strength training, and yoga. By adding variety to your routine, you’ll stay engaged and motivated.
4. Create a Fun Playlist
Music has a powerful impact on our mood and energy levels. Creating a workout playlist with your favorite upbeat songs can make a world of difference. Choose songs that make you want to dance, sing along, or push your limits.
The right music can boost your motivation and make your workouts more enjoyable.
5. Set Rewards
Intrinsic motivation is important, but external rewards can also be a great way to keep yourself motivated. Set small rewards for reaching certain fitness milestones. Treat yourself to a massage, buy new workout gear, or enjoy a guilt-free cheat meal.
These rewards can give you something to look forward to and make your fitness journey feel even more gratifying.
6. Find a Workout Buddy
Exercising with a friend or a workout buddy can make your fitness routine much more enjoyable. Not only will you have someone to share your journey with, but you’ll also have someone to hold you accountable and push you to do better.
Choose a workout buddy who has a similar fitness level and goals as you, and together, you can make working out a fun social activity.
7. Track Your Progress
Tracking your progress can provide a sense of accomplishment and keep you motivated. Use a fitness app or a journal to record your daily or weekly achievements.
Seeing how far you’ve come can boost your confidence and encourage you to keep pushing yourself.
8. Make It a Habit
Consistency is key when it comes to enjoying your workouts. Make exercising a habit by scheduling it into your daily routine. Treat it as a non-negotiable appointment with yourself.
The more you stick to your routine, the easier it becomes, and soon enough, working out will feel like second nature.
9. Incorporate Mindfulness
Often, we get so caught up in the physical aspects of working out that we forget about the mental benefits. Incorporating mindfulness into your fitness routine can enhance your overall experience.
Practice deep breathing or meditation before or after your workouts to center your mind and enjoy the present moment.
10. Focus on the Positive
Lastly, shift your focus from the things you dislike about working out to the positive aspects. Instead of dreading the effort, think about how energized and accomplished you feel afterward.
Remind yourself of the physical and mental benefits of exercise, such as increased strength, improved mood, and reduced stress. By reframing your mindset, you can start appreciating the experience.
